Summary
Northeast Delta Human Services Authority is seeking a Social Worker 4 to lead the development and implementation of advanced, individualized case management and treatment plans. In this vital role, you'll work closely with individuals and families to address complex needs, challenges, and emotional or behavioral concerns, helping them navigate toward healthier, more stable lives.

Job Duties:- Works with a treatment team to provide quality care and reduce the stigma surrounding behavioral health (mental health and substance use) treatment. To do this, the selected individual must utilize available community resources and/or referrals to a care manager and provide psychiatric assistance to consumers who have a behavioral health diagnosis.
- Provides ongoing therapy, including crisis intervention, to individuals and families in one-on-one and/or group treatment.
- Plans, prioritizes, and manages clinical treatment services for complex behavioral health cases. This includes completion of initial biopsychosocial assessments, annual reassessments, ASIs, and all assigned screening tools in accordance with NEDHSA policy.
- Develops and implements treatment plans for consumers receiving services related to a behavioral health diagnosis, in accordance with LDH guidelines.
- Attends in-service trainings for staff and completes required trainings promptly and assists with the collection of data for the TOMS and QOC surveys, as assigned.
